Enhanced Customer Service: Sophisticated AI-powered chatbots will be able to handle complex customer queries instantly, 24/7, providing a level of service that is faster and casino (220.112.1.148) more efficient than human agents for routine issues. Advanced Responsible Gambling: By analyzing gameplay data in real-time, AI can identify patterns of behavior that may indicate problem gambling (such as chasing losses or a sudden, drastic increase in play time) and proactively intervene by offering cooling-off periods or directing the player to support resources. Personalized Gaming: The casino's interface could dynamically change to show you the games you're most likely to enjoy, or it could offer you bonuses and promotions that are tailored specifically to your preferences, rather than generic offers.

Higher-Tier Comps (For "High Rollers"):
RFB (Room, Food, and Beverage): This is reserved for players with a high theoretical loss. A Casino Host: High-volume players are assigned a personal casino host who acts as their concierge, arranging all their comps, making dinner reservations, and ensuring they have a seamless experience. Limo Service and Show Tickets: Complimentary transportation to and casino (repo.edtechworld.pl) from the airport and free tickets to the best shows are common perks for valuable players. Airfare Reimbursement: For top-tier players, the casino (47.99.98.98) may even pay for their flights to and from the resort.
